Los Angeles Lakers Vs. Dallas Mavericks NBA Highlights

The Los Angeles Lakers went to Dallas to make an attempt to win their fourth game of the season and third in as many games. Nick Young has added the spark the Lakers needed from their bench, as he’s averaged 16.5 points in the two wins since his return. The Mavericks came into the game at third in the Western Conference with a 9-3 record while the Lakers were second to last with a 3-9 record. Take a look at how the game went for the Lakers below:
